This year’s vintage cuvée brings together five high-altitude cacao varieties, led by the renowned Chuncho heirloom cacao and complemented by distinctive beans from Colombia, Ecuador, Guatemala, and Uganda. The resulting flavor profile is remarkably smooth and balanced, with bright notes of red berries, roasted pecans, and layers of cacao and delicate florals. The experience begins with a creamy, almond-like chocolate taste, unfolding into a mild marzipan and spice character. Subtle hints of fresh grass and herbs appear, underscored by gentle ginger, which enhances the chocolate’s roasted depth and complexity. Each bite finishes with lush Morello cherries, enlivened by tangy kombucha and yogurt notes, and ends on a mellow malty roast with a lingering chocolatey aftertaste and very little bitterness.
A summit of mountain-grown cacao: Most cacao is cultivated in the lowlands, but this exceptional cuvée features beans selected from the highland regions of Ecuador, Colombia, Guatemala, Peru, and Uganda. The result is a bold, exquisitely dark chocolate with 77% cacao, shaped by five origins, unique altitudes, and an alluringly fruity, berry-forward aroma.
